How does Prinsburg, MN compare to St. Anthony city (Hennepin and Ramsey Counties), Minnesota, MN? Prinsburg has a population of 615 with a median household income of $105,323, while St. Anthony city (Hennepin and Ramsey Counties), Minnesota has 9,516 residents and a median income of $97,784.
